Lucifer is finally returning to Netflix with new episodes. TV Line reports that the fan favorite series will be back at the end of May on the streaming service.
Lucifer‘s season five first premiered in April of 2020 and aired eight episodes of the planned 16 episodes. As the series picked up filming in September, following a total shutdown due to the pandemic, Netflix will be starting to air the second half of the season fairly shortly. D.B.
